You can replace the SetName with MakeNameEx function:
MakeNameEx:
// Rename an address
// ea - linear address
// name - new name of address. If name == "", then delete old name
// flags - combination of SN_... constants
// returns: 1-ok, 0-failure

MakeNameEx(long ea,string name,long flags);

#define SN_CHECK 0x01 // Fail if the name contains invalid characters
// If this bit is clear, all invalid chars
// (those !is_ident_char()) will be replaced
// by SubstChar (usually '_')
// List of valid characters is defined in ida.cfg
#define SN_NOCHECK 0x00 // Replace invalid chars with SubstChar
#define SN_PUBLIC 0x02 // if set, make name public
#define SN_NON_PUBLIC 0x04 // if set, make name non-public
#define SN_WEAK 0x08 // if set, make name weak
#define SN_NON_WEAK 0x10 // if set, make name non-weak
#define SN_AUTO 0x20 // if set, make name autogenerated
#define SN_NON_AUTO 0x40 // if set, make name non-autogenerated
#define SN_NOLIST 0x80 // if set, exclude name from the list
// if not set, then include the name into
// the list (however, if other bits are set,
// the name might be immediately excluded
// from the list)
#define SN_NOWARN 0x100 // don't display a warning if failed
#define SN_LOCAL 0x200 // create local name. a function should exist.
// local names can't be public or weak.
// also they are not included into the list of names
// they can't have dummy prefixes
